ASSOCIATED STUDENT BODY (ASB) FUNDS
Associated Student Body (ASB) funds are public monies raised on behalf of students, and are used for optional, extra-curricular events of a cultural, athletic, recreational, or social nature.
At Evergreen, ASB helps fund after school clubs, dances, sports and other special activities.
ASB cards cost $15. If you filled out the Family Income Survey (below), you may qualify for waived or reduced price costs.
ASB Fee The ASB fee has been reinstated and is $15. If your student is attending an ASB club or sports please go to https://wa-federalway.intouchreceipting.com/ to pay the fee.
Possible fee waiver: If you have filled out the Family Income Survey (https://www.fwps.org/departments/nutrition-services/family-income-survey ) and have given consent to a Fee Waiver during the annual online verification, this fee may be waived. If qualified, your total will show zero dollars due. However, finish the "payment" process so your student is listed as an ASB member.
Even if your student is not attending a club you can purchase an ASB Activity Card. As an ASB member, students get discounts at district games, and it helps fund Evergreen ASB clubs, dances, Field Day and more!

Fee Waivers:
Students who qualify for free and reduced-price meals may be eligible for waived or reduced fees to participate in and/or attend extracurricular activities and more. Parents or legal guardians must give consent annually to share school meal eligibility information with other school officials for fee waivers/reductions to be applied.
- STEP 1: Complete the Family Income Survey
- STEP 2: Complete Enrollment or annual verification in ParentVUE starting August 1, 2023. (The Fee Waiver option is available during the enrollment or annual verification process.)
If consent is given, please allow 1-2 business days to be activated in the fee waiver program(s). Once activated, fee waiver eligible items will be automatically waived at purchase through the FWPS Payment Portal or school office. Fee waivers are not applied retroactively, and fees paid prior to becoming active in the fee waiver program are not refundable.
Teaching and Coaching
My job as instructional coach is primarily to mentor the teachers at Evergreen Middle School. I go into classes and I observe their teaching. I give them feedback and ask them to reflect. I plan and deliver their training. It is quite fulfilling to see a teacher go from a novice to a master teacher through this process. I think teachers find the support beneficial.
A problem with instructional coaching all the time is you can start to forget how to teach. You begin to neglect the practical realities of teaching real humans in favor of the more abstract and theoretical. I feel like this is what happens to the university professors who train our student teachers. They become too far removed from the classroom.
This is part of the reason why I decided to start teaching a small group once a day for 20 minutes. I started by testing students for a set of skills, and I am using a scripted program to address their gaps. The teaching is fast paced and based on research-based principles – the same ones I teach the teachers. In addition to growing our scholars’ math skills, it is strengthening my connection to the classroom, which has made me a better instructional coach.
